Output 050659316cece47f35d77f684da11e4e36857675df49101bdf7884718d5a6d53:9

value
1660000
script pubkey
OP_0 OP_PUSHBYTES_32 ce248d13412431c4a226c84a7aef82723167c54583060d1e072cfa66b7612d33
address
bc1qecjg6y6pyscufg3xep984muzwgck0329svrq68s89naxddmp95ess8fepv
transaction
050659316cece47f35d77f684da11e4e36857675df49101bdf7884718d5a6d53
spent
true